Mold Inspection & Testing

Most Menifee homeowners call us after seeing staining on a wall or smelling something that won’t go away. In Sun City homes built between 1963 and the late 1970s, the source is frequently a galvanized supply line failing under the slab, saturating concrete and the clay below without ever showing water on the floor. Our inspection starts with thermal imaging and in-slab relative humidity probes, not just a visual walkthrough. We map the moisture plume, test air samples against outdoor baselines, and tell you exactly what’s growing and where it’s coming from. A typical mold inspection in Menifee runs $350 to $750, with a full testing protocol for larger homes.

Mold Removal

Removal means containment, air scrubbing with XPOWER air movers, physical removal of affected drywall and insulation, and antimicrobial encapsulation of open cavities. In Menifee’s production-tract homes, we find mold concentrated at slab penetrations where plumbing rises through the floor and the expansive clay has shifted the connection over the years. We set containment, run negative air, and remove anything that can’t be dried. A typical single-room mold removal in Menifee runs $1,500 to $4,000. Larger jobs involving multiple rooms or opened slab trenches run $4,000 to $9,000.

Black Mold Remediation

Black mold, Stachybotrys chartarum, grows where moisture sits for weeks. Menifee’s summer heat pushes indoor humidity up when homes are closed without air running, especially in the older Sun City houses without modern ventilation. We treat black mold as a serious health concern, not a cosmetic one. Full containment, HEPA filtration, and careful disposal go with every black mold job. A Menifee black mold remediation typically costs $2,500 to $7,500 depending on how far the moisture traveled and how much framing is compromised.

Air Quality Restoration

After removal, the air in your Menifee home should test cleaner than it did before the problem started. We run HEPA air scrubbers during and after remediation, then retest before we lift containment. For homeowners in Sun City who spend most of their time indoors, restored air quality matters as much as the visible cleanup. Menifee residents with allergies or respiratory concerns often ask us to run a final post-remediation verification test so they have written proof the indoor air returned to acceptable levels. Air quality restoration runs $800 to $2,500 depending on home size and test scope.

What Menifee Homeowners Should Know About Mold and Slab Leaks

In Menifee’s Sun City section, 1960s-era slab homes have galvanized supply lines cast directly into the concrete; as those lines corrode internally from Riverside County’s moderately hard water, they fail under the slab and silently saturate both the concrete and the expansive clay beneath before any surface sign appears. That’s the part that surprises people. No wet floor. No dripping sound. Just a wall that smells musty in July and a baseboard that keeps staining no matter how many times you paint it.

We recently remediated a 1965 Sun City slab home on a quiet cul-de-sac off Murrieta Road where a pinholed galvanized line had been weeping under the slab for months. Our techs used thermal imaging and in-slab relative humidity probes to map the moisture plume, then ran Injectidry drying mats and a Phoenix desiccant to pull the slab’s retained moisture below 55% relative humidity before air-scrubbing with XPOWER air movers and applying an antimicrobial encapsulant to the open drywall cavities. The homeowner had lived in that house for 34 years and never saw a drop of water. The mold was growing behind the baseboards upstairs, fed by moisture traveling up through the wall cavities from the wet slab below.

Newer Menifee homes fail differently. In Audie Murphy Ranch and Menifee Lakes, the expansive clay under the slab swells in winter rains and shrinks through the summer. That movement stresses slab penetrations and supply-line joints until they crack. The failure is usually at a plumbing riser or a wall transition, and the water shows up faster than a sub-slab pinhole leak. But the fix requires the same diligence: map the moisture, dry the structure to the dry standard, and log every reading.

Common Mold Problems We See in Menifee Homes

  • Hidden sub-slab moisture in 1960s Sun City homes. Corroded galvanized lines saturate concrete and expansive clay without visible surface staining. By the time mold appears behind baseboards, the slab has often been wet for months.
  • Underestimated drying timelines on expansive clay. Menifee’s clay soils re-crack seasonally, which can reintroduce moisture at slab penetrations before the first remediation pass is fully dry. We plan for extended structural drying from day one.
  • Winter condensation in uninsulated exterior walls. Menifee’s winter overnight lows drop into the high 20s°F, colder than nearby Temecula. Homes built with Southern California’s minimal insulation standards get condensation inside exterior wall cavities, and that feeds mold even without a leak.
  • Closed-up homes in summer. Snowbirds who leave Menifee for months often return to musty smells because the air hasn’t moved and humidity built up. We see this in Menifee Lakes and Sun City every October.

Pricing for Mold Remediation in Menifee, CA

Here’s what Menifee homeowners can expect, based on jobs we’ve done across the city:

Service Typical Menifee Range
Mold Inspection & Testing $350 - $750
Single-Room Mold Removal $1,500 - $4,000
Black Mold Remediation $2,500 - $7,500
Air Quality Restoration $800 - $2,500
Crawl Space Treatment $1,200 - $3,800
Moisture & Humidity Control $600 - $2,200

Square footage, how far the moisture traveled, and whether slab trenches need to be opened all move the final number. A Menifee slab-on-grade home with a sub-slab leak and mold in two rooms usually lands between $5,000 and $9,000 once drying and rebuild are included.
